Each year, 150 babies die in Franklin County before reaching the age of one. That's about 3 babies each week. One way to help babies be as strong and healthy as possible is to protect them from secondhand smoke.

If you smoke while you are pregnant, or let anyone smoke near your baby, he or she is lighting up too, and it is harmful to their health.
